Also, get to know further problems and the best treatment for ear pressure and sinus pain at the same time. What Causes Sinus & Ear Pain at the Same Time? As you already know, the sinus causes headaches due to any reason like a common cold, running nose, clogged nostrils, flu, allergies, irritants, or can be anything. Sometimes, sinus pain causes further dizziness, weakness, and congestion in the ears as well. It happens when the Eustachian Tube does not function properly and becomes clogged. Eustachian Tube is a small canal between your nose and the middle of the ear. Thus, whenever you feel the pain of the sinus, mainly caused due to nasal issue, then Eustachian Tube might obstruct the pressure movement. In short, all of these cause severe ear pain and sinus at the same point in time. Situations: When do you have to see an ENT Specialist? Now, you know the reason for the doubt impact of the sinus pain causing earache as well. Make no more delays in seeing an ENT specialist under the following few circumstances. * If you have a fever higher than 102.2 degrees Fahrenheit (39 degrees Celsius). * If you are experiencing nasal discharge or facial pain which on a greater side for more than 3 days. * Nasal discharge and cough at the same time for more than nine consecutive days. * Serious sinus infection for more than a week.
